About the watch: The reference 6429 was sold only in the United States, and only through two channels: U.S. military bases comes with blank dial without “Commando” at 6 o’clock and Abercrombie & Fitch with “Commando” printed in the dial. the Commando was produced for just a year or two in the late 1960s or 1970, this makes it an extremely rare model. Only handful known with blank dial.

The Commando features an Oyster case measuring 34mm in diameter. What makes the Commando so attractive is its matte black “Explorer” dial, featuring the 3-6-9.

With a manual movement ticking inside, the Commando sits slimmer on the wrist than most other Rolex sports models. It is powered by the manual wind caliber 1225.
